Title :
Cache Sharing and Isolation Tradeoffs in Multicore Mixed-Criticality Systems
Author :
Micaiah Chisholm;Bryan C. Ward;Namhoon Kim;James H. Anderson
Author_Institution :
Dept. of Comput. Sci., Univ. of North Carolina at Chapel Hill, Chapel Hill, NC, USA
Abstract :
In mixed-critical applications, tension exists between sharing and isolation with respect to hardware resources: while strong isolation might be required for highly critical tasks, somewhat permissive sharing might be reasonable for less critical tasks to improve throughput or average-case performance. In this paper, this tension is examined as it pertains to shared last-level caches (LLCs) on multicore platforms. In particular, criticality-aware optimization techniques based on linear programming are presented for allocating LLC areas in the context of the previously proposed MC2 (mixed-criticality on multicore) framework. Experiments are also presented that show that these techniques can result in significant schedulability improvements.
Keywords :
"Resource management","Positron emission tomography","Multicore processing","Hardware","Real-time systems","Color","Context"
Conference_Titel :
Real-Time Systems Symposium, 2015 IEEE
Print_ISBN :
978-1-4673-9507-6
DOI :
10.1109/RTSS.2015.36